If a teenager of your acquaintance suffered the loss of her mother, would you know what to do or say? The stock phrases used at funerals feel so empty; are they of any help to a teenager? This book shows one woman’s experience of when it happened to her as a teen. It describes some of the errors of “common wisdom” and shows that children and teens grieve differently from, and later than, adults. Adults grieve immediately, and some grieve more openly than others do. It’s a typical impulse to want to shy away from others for a time. Children and teens are emotionally incapable of processing such loss. While the adults around them are grieving and wish to back away, children need the closeness and reassurance the most. Dads need to “do something.” Teens especially need to live with emotional stability and learn coping skills for life. The family’s pattern can change from drifting apart because of loss, to gathering closer for emotional support, stability and life lessons. Whether you’re a daughter, son, dad, grandparent, aunt, uncle, cousin, minister, teacher, counselor, friend or confidant, this book can give you helpful insights. This book was written to teenage girls, explained with the help of interesting characters. The situation can be scary, but the information inside shows how one grown daughter came through.
